A Brief Primer on Supercell Formation
Supercells are a type of thunderstorm characterized by a rotating updraft, or mesocyclone. These rotating columns of air can extend several miles into the atmosphere, creating a perfect storm of moisture, wind shear, and instability. When the conditions are just right, a supercell can form, bringing with it a range of severe weather phenomena.

The 5 Steps to Tracking Down Supercell Ids
So, how can you unlock the secrets of supercells and track down supercell ids? The answer lies in a combination of science, technology, and observation. Here are the 5 steps to tracking down supercell ids:
- Step 1: Understand the Atmospheric Conditions
- Step 2: Identify the Precursors to Supercell Formation
- Step 3: Use Radar and Satellite Imagery to Identify the Supercell
- Step 4: Monitor Surface Observations and Reports
- Step 5: Use Machine Learning and Modeling to Predict Supercell Activity
Before a supercell can form, the atmosphere must be in a state of instability, with warm air rising rapidly and cool air sinking. This requires a combination of moisture, wind shear, and lift.
Supercells often form in areas where a strong low-pressure system is developing. This can be signaled by a change in wind direction and speed, as well as an increase in cloud cover.
Radar and satellite imagery can provide critical information on the development and movement of supercells. By analyzing the data from these sources, researchers can track the supercell's movement and intensity.
Surface observations and reports from storm chasers and residents can provide valuable information on the supercell's severity and location. By combining this data with radar and satellite imagery, researchers can gain a more complete understanding of the supercell's behavior.
By analyzing large datasets and using machine learning algorithms, researchers can develop predictive models that forecast supercell activity with increasing accuracy. This can help emergency managers and storm chasers prepare for and respond to supercells in real-time.
